H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ES

H.B. NO.

1331

TWENTY-SEVENTH LEGISLATURE, 2013

 

STATE OF HAWAII

 

 

 

 

 

 

A BILL FOR AN ACT

 

 

relating to labeling.

 

 

B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F HAWAII:

 


     SECTION 1.  Chapter 486, Hawaii Revised Statutes, is amended by adding a new section to part V to be appropriately designated and to read as follows:

     "§486-     Molokai- and Lanai-made products; certification.  (a)  The board shall establish a certification process under which any food, item, product, souvenir, or any other merchandise that is grown, manufactured, assembled, fabricated, or produced on the island of Molokai or Lanai, respectively, may contain "Molokai" or "Lanai" on the front label.

     (b)  No person shall keep, offer, display or expose for sale, or solicit for the sale of any food, item, product, souvenir, or any other merchandise that is labeled "Molokai" or "Lanai", or by any other means represents the origin of the item as being from Molokai or Lanai, unless the food, item, product, souvenir, or merchandise has been certified pursuant to subsection (a).

     (c)  The board shall adopt rules pursuant to chapter 91 to implement this section."

     SECTION 2.  New statutory material is underscored.

     SECTION 3.  This Act shall take effect on July 1, 2013.

Report Title:

Board of Agriculture; Molokai; Lanai; Labeling; Certification

 

Description:

Requires the board of agriculture to establish a certification process for products containing "Molokai" or "Lanai" on the front label.  Prohibits any person from using "Molokai" or "Lanai" on the label unless the product has been certified by the board.  Effective 07/01/2013.
